* Gprbuild relies on a configuration file listing all available compilers (auto.cgpr is used by default). You may create such a file with the gprconfig tool, but if you don't gprbuild will run "gprconfig -o auto.cgpr" by itself (transmitting --db options). * Gprconfig relies on a configuration directory listing all known compilers (/usr/share/gprconfig is used by default). You may provide your own modified copy with the --db options. * In case you need to replace the knowledge base: gprconfig --db- --db yourdb (generates default.gpr that you may check) gprbuild yourproject.gpr (using default.gpr) Exhaustive documentation can be found at http://docs.adacore.com/gprbuild-docs/html/gprbuild_ug.html. The upstream database lists various compilers in their default version (like /usr/bin/gcc). For each language, unless an explicit choice is made, gprbuild selects the first detected compiler, starting with the default version. Be warned that, for projects mixing languages, the default behaviour may result in mixing incompatible ABIs, for example when gcc->gcc-x.y and gnat->gnat-z.t. We try to ensure that this never happens Debian stable distributions. However, you may override the default locally with # gprconfig --config=Ada --config=C,,,,gcc-z.t in order to create a dedicated .cgpr configuration in the current directory before running gprbuild. This package follows the convention for Ada library packages in Debian documented in http://people.debian.org/~lbrenta/debian-ada-policy.html. The 'gpr' library is renamed 'gnatprj' in order to avoid a clash with the 'grpc' source package (#945197). -- Nicolas Boulenguez , Mon, 2 Dec 2019 22:45:06 +0100
